Cinda International Files Director List with HKEX

Cinda International Holdings Limited has filed an updated list of directors with the Hong Kong Stock Exchange, effective from December 1, 2025. The board comprises Executive Directors Zhan Jiang (Chairman), Zhang Xunyuan (Chief Executive Officer), and Yan Qizhong (Chief Financial Officer). The Independent Non-executive Directors are Hu Lielei, Zhao Guangming, and Li Ying. In terms of committee memberships, Hu Lielei serves as Chairman of the Audit Committee and is a member of both the Remuneration and Nomination Committees. Li Ying chairs the Remuneration Committee and is a member of the Audit Committee. Zhao Guangming is a member of all three committees. Zhan Jiang chairs the Nomination Committee. The company states that these appointments aim to strengthen its corporate governance structure.
